Illumination: Polarized vs. Non-polarized, LED vs. Halogen

The illumination system of a portable dermatoscope significantly impacts its diagnostic capabilities. There are two primary illumination technologies to consider:

Polarized vs. Non-polarized Light

Polarized handheld dermatoscopes eliminate surface reflection, allowing visualization of deeper skin structures. This is particularly valuable for examining pigmented lesions and vascular structures. Non-polarized models, while less expensive, may require contact fluids to achieve similar visualization depth.

LED vs. Halogen Lighting

Modern LED illumination offers several advantages over traditional halogen:

  • Longer lifespan (typically 50,000 hours vs. 1,000 for halogen)
  • Cooler operation (reducing patient discomfort)
  • More consistent color temperature
  • Lower power consumption

Some high-end handheld dermatoscopes now feature adjustable LED intensity and color temperature, allowing clinicians to optimize illumination for different skin types and conditions.

Ergonomics: Weight, grip, and ease of use

Ergonomics play a crucial role in the daily usability of a handheld dermatoscope. Key ergonomic factors include:

Weight: Lightweight models (under 300g) reduce hand fatigue during extended use. However, some clinicians prefer slightly heavier devices for improved stability.

Grip Design: Contoured grips with non-slip surfaces enhance control and comfort. Some models feature adjustable finger rests to accommodate different hand sizes.

Button Placement: Intuitive control placement allows for one-handed operation, with important functions (like image capture) easily accessible without shifting grip.

For clinicians performing numerous examinations daily, these ergonomic considerations can significantly impact both comfort and examination quality.
